- Daniel de Leon
Daniel De Leon was a Curaçao-born American socialist and Syndicalism-influenced trade unionist of Jewish origin. He was educated in Germany and the Netherlands and arrived in the United States in 1874. De Leon settled in New York City, studying at Columbia University. He became a committed socialist during the 1886 Mayoral campaign of Henry George and in 1890 joined the Socialist Labor Party (SLP), becoming the editor of its newspaper, "The People".

- Kim Darby
Kim Darby (born Deborah Zerby on July 8,1947 in Los Angeles, California although her father insisted on calling her Derby Zerby because he believed it was a great stagename) is an American actress, daughter of professional dancers John and Inga Zerby. She began acting at age 15 and has appeared in many films and television shows. Her first appearance was as a dancer in the 1963 film "Bye Bye Birdie".
- Victoria Newton
Victoria Newton born in London), is a English journalist and showbiz correspondent. She currently edits the "Bizarre" showbiz column of Rupert Murdoch's "The Sun" newspaper. Newton arrived on Fleet Street with the Daily Express in 1993, and then started the showbiz beat at The People. In 1998, she became an assistant to Dominic Mohan on The Sun's Bizarre pages, before becoming the paper's Los Angeles correspondent in 1999.

- Kenneth Matiba
Kenneth Matiba is Kenyan politician. Kenneth Matiba was the chairman of Kenya Football Federation from 1974 to 1978. Later he served as a Minister of Transport and Communications, under the KANU administration led by then president Daniel Arap Moi, but Matiba resigned from his post in December 1988. Matiba was detained at the Kamiti Maximum Security Prison in 1990 without trial.
- Diane Varsi
Diane Marie Varsi (February 23, 1938 - November 19, 1992) was an American film and television actor. Born in San Mateo, California, Varsi made her screen debut in "Peyton Place" (1957), and received a nomination for an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ress for her performance. The same year, she shared a Golden Globe as "Most Promising Newcomer" with Sandra Dee and Carolyn Jones.

- Nguyen Quoc Chanh
Nguyen Quoc Chanh is a Vietnamese poet. He was born in Bac Lieu, and now lives in Ho Chi Minh City. He is the author of four collections of poems, "Night of the Rising Sun" ("Đêm mặt trời mọc" 1990), "Inanimate Weather" ("Khí hậu đồ vật" 1997), the e-book "Coded Personal Info" (Của căn cước ẩn dụ 2001) and the samizdat "Hey, I'm Here" ("Ê, tao đây" 2005).
- Denis Pitts
Denis Pitts (b. January 6, 1930 - d. April 19, 1994) journalist, film-maker and novelist. Denis Pitts first became widely known for his reports on the Suez Crisis and his subsequent articles in the New Statesman. In Suez he made the acquaintance of Michael Parkinson, who at the time was in charge of liaising with the press, and they would later work together for the Granada regional news programme, Scene at 6.30.
